Krungthai Card Public Company Limited, commonly known as KTC, is a leading financial services provider headquartered in Thailand. Established in 1996, KTC has grown to become a prominent player in the credit card and personal loan sectors, serving customers across major regions in Thailand. The company offers a diverse range of products, including credit cards, personal loans, and various financial solutions tailored to meet the needs of its clientele. In 2018, Krungthai Card Public Company Limited reported carbon emissions of approximately 53,221,320 kg CO2e from Scope 2 sources in Thailand. This figure reflects the company's commitment to monitoring and managing its carbon footprint, although no data is available for Scope 1 or Scope 3 emissions. The company's emissions have shown some fluctuation over the years, with 2017 emissions recorded at about 120,894,910 kg CO2e in Thailand and 6,751,530 kg CO2e globally. In 2016, the emissions were approximately 128,115,820 kg CO2e in Thailand and 6,786,350 kg CO2e globally. Despite these figures, Krungthai Card has not set specific reduction targets or initiatives as part of its climate commitments, indicating a potential area for future development in their sustainability strategy. The absence of Science-Based Targets Initiative (SBTi) reduction targets suggests that the company may need to enhance its climate action framework to align with industry standards.
